Red and white crochet skirts bring handcrafted texture, bold contrast, and playful character into an everyday wardrobe. The best 25 red and white crochet skirt outfit ideas move far beyond beachwear. These skirts can work with crisp tailoring, relaxed denim, sporty basics, polished work pieces, and elegant evening layers. The key is to let the crochet texture lead while supporting it with simpler fabrics and thoughtful proportions. A fitted top balances a flared skirt, while an oversized jacket can modernize a slim crochet silhouette. Shoes and accessories also change the mood instantly, taking the same color pairing from casual to refined. Whether you prefer minis, midis, maxis, stripes, checks, or granny squares, the following 25 red and white crochet skirt outfit ideas offer complete looks for every wardrobe.

1. Red And White Granny Square Mini Skirt With Denim Jacket

A red and white granny square mini skirt feels casual and modern when paired with familiar denim. Wear it with a fitted white crew-neck T-shirt tucked neatly into the waistband. Add a relaxed, light-wash denim jacket that ends near the hips without covering the skirt’s colorful squares. White leather sneakers keep the outfit practical for shopping, sightseeing, or a casual lunch. Choose a compact red shoulder bag to repeat the brighter yarn color without overwhelming the look. Small silver hoops and narrow sunglasses provide a clean finish. If the crochet openings are wide, add fitted white shorts underneath. This combination makes the handmade skirt feel approachable because the supporting pieces are simple, structured, and easy to find in an everyday closet.
2. Red And White Striped Midi Crochet Skirt With Black Blazer

Can a striped crochet skirt look polished enough for work? A red and white striped midi crochet skirt becomes office-friendly when styled with a fitted black tank and a softly tailored black blazer. Choose a skirt with a lining and a straight or gently flared shape for comfortable coverage. Black slingback pumps create a refined line, while a structured top-handle bag gives the outfit a professional finish. Keep jewelry understated with a slim watch and small gold earrings. The black layers frame the bold red-and-white pattern and prevent it from looking overly playful. For a more conservative workplace, button the blazer and select a high-neck tank. This outfit works especially well for creative offices, presentations, gallery events, and polished daytime appointments.
3. Red And White Chevron Maxi Crochet Skirt With White Button-Down Shirt

Flowing chevron patterns deserve a crisp piece that brings visual balance. Style a red and white chevron maxi crochet skirt with an oversized white button-down shirt, loosely tucked at the front. Roll the sleeves to the elbows so the outfit feels relaxed rather than formal. Add tan flat leather sandals and a medium brown woven tote for a grounded, natural finish. A slim leather belt can define the waist if the skirt has a flexible drawstring waistband. Complete the look with simple gold hoops and softly pulled-back hair. The clean shirt keeps the zigzag pattern from becoming too busy, while the long skirt delivers movement. This is an easy option for warm weekends, vacation dinners, outdoor markets, and casual summer gatherings.
4. Red And White Checkered Crochet Mini Skirt With Rugby Shirt

Give a red and white checkered crochet mini skirt a fresh sporty direction with a relaxed rugby shirt. Choose a navy-and-white top with a structured collar and tuck only the front into the skirt. The slightly oversized shirt contrasts nicely with the fitted crochet shape while providing comfortable coverage around the hips. Add white crew socks and retro navy sneakers to continue the athletic mood. A small red nylon crossbody bag keeps your hands free and connects with the skirt. Avoid extra patterns so the checkered crochet remains the focus. This playful outfit is suitable for campus, casual weekend plans, sporting events, or travel days. Fitted shorts beneath the skirt provide extra coverage without changing the head-to-toe appearance.

6. Red And White Scalloped Crochet Pencil Skirt With Knit Polo

A red and white scalloped crochet pencil skirt can look surprisingly refined when its texture is balanced by a smooth knit polo. Choose a fitted short-sleeve polo in deep navy and tuck it fully into the skirt. The dark top creates a clean outline and lets the scalloped hem remain visible. Add pointed cream flats or low block heels, depending on how dressy you want the outfit to feel. Carry a structured burgundy handbag for a subtle tonal connection to the red crochet. A slim belt and pearl studs bring quiet polish without making the outfit look dated. Make sure the pencil skirt has a flexible lining and a back slit. This combination is ideal for business-casual settings, lunches, daytime celebrations, and creative professional events.
7. Red And White Mesh Crochet Maxi Skirt With Bodysuit

Sheer texture becomes easier to wear when the base layer looks deliberate. Style a red and white mesh crochet maxi skirt with a smooth white bodysuit and fitted white shorts or a matching mini slip underneath. Add a cropped red bomber jacket to create a strong waistline and introduce a modern streetwear influence. White platform sneakers keep the long hem away from the ground while making the outfit comfortable for walking. Finish with a silver shoulder bag and sculptural silver earrings. The clean bodysuit prevents unnecessary bulk beneath the open crochet stitches. Meanwhile, the bomber jacket gives the skirt structure and separates it from its usual resort associations. Wear this confident combination to music events, city outings, creative gatherings, or casual evening plans.

9. Red And White A-Line Crochet Skirt With Trench Coat

Transitional weather is the perfect setting for a red and white A-line crochet skirt. Begin with a lightweight black mock-neck top tucked into the skirt, then add a classic stone-colored trench coat. Leave the coat open so the crochet pattern remains clearly visible. Black ankle boots provide stability and introduce a smooth texture that contrasts with the handmade skirt. Carry a structured red satchel and add sheer black tights if the temperature is cool. The A-line shape sits neatly under the longer coat without producing excessive volume. A simple gold chain and tidy low bun complete the polished appearance. This outfit works for commuting, city walks, gallery visits, and daytime events during early fall or a mild spring.

15. Red And White Circle Crochet Skirt With Fitted Turtleneck

A full red and white circle crochet skirt creates a strong waist and plenty of movement. Balance that volume with a fitted black turtleneck tucked smoothly into the waistband. Add black pointed pumps or refined ankle boots to lengthen the line of the legs. A slim red belt can emphasize the waist, while a small black top-handle bag keeps the silhouette polished. Choose simple earrings and avoid a statement necklace, since the skirt already provides substantial detail. In colder weather, add a tailored black wool coat that ends below the skirt’s widest point. This complete outfit combines handcrafted texture with classic shapes, making it suitable for work events, luncheons, exhibitions, and seasonal gatherings without relying on a predictable bohemian or vacation-inspired formula.

Conclusion:
These 25 red and white crochet skirt outfit ideas show how easily handcrafted texture can fit into a modern wardrobe. A crochet skirt does not have to be reserved for vacations, festivals, or bohemian outfits. It can look polished with blazers, relaxed with denim, sporty with sneakers, or elegant with satin and refined heels. Focus on proportion, coverage, and texture when building each look. Smooth tops help intricate stitches stand out, while structured outerwear gives softer skirts a more defined shape. Most importantly, choose combinations that suit your routine and comfort level. With the right supporting pieces, a red and white crochet skirt becomes a versatile statement item you can wear through multiple seasons and occasions.
